并行计算在人工智能与机器学习中的应用.pptx

并行计算在人工智能与机器学习中的应用.pptx

  1. 1、本文档共32页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

并行计算在人工智能与机器学习中的应用

并行计算概述与分类

并行计算技术在人工智能中的应用

并行计算技术在机器学习中的应用

并行计算技术在深度学习中的应用

并行计算技术在自然语言处理中的应用

并行计算技术在计算机视觉中的应用

并行计算技术在数据挖掘中的应用

并行计算技术在医学影像分析中的应用ContentsPage目录页

并行计算概述与分类并行计算在人工智能与机器学习中的应用

并行计算概述与分类并行计算的概念和特点1.并行计算是利用多核处理器或计算机进行计算的一种方法,其核心思想是将任务分解成多个小任务,然后分别在不同的处理器或计算机上同时执行,以提高计算速度和效率。2.并行计算的特点包括:①并发性:并行计算允许多个任务同时执行,提高计算效率。②高效性:并行计算通过充分利用处理器或计算机的计算资源,提高计算性能。③可扩展性:并行计算可以通过增加处理器或计算机的数量来扩展计算能力。并行计算的分类1.并行计算可以分为以下三类:①多处理器并行计算:使用多核处理器或多个处理器进行计算,每个处理器负责一个子任务。②分布式并行计算:使用多个计算机进行计算,每个计算机负责一个子任务,通过网络通信进行协作。③异构并行计算:使用不同类型的处理器或计算机进行计算,例如,使用CPU和GPU进行计算。

并行计算概述与分类并行计算的应用领域1.并行计算广泛应用于各个领域,包括:①人工智能和机器学习:并行计算用于训练和运行人工智能和机器学习模型。②气象预报:并行计算用于模拟天气变化,生成天气预报。③医学研究:并行计算用于分析基因数据、蛋白质数据等,辅助医学研究。④金融分析:并行计算用于分析金融数据,进行股票投资、风险评估等。

并行计算技术在人工智能中的应用并行计算在人工智能与机器学习中的应用

并行计算技术在人工智能中的应用并行计算在人工智能中的应用,1.并行计算技术的特点:-并行计算技术可以将大型复杂的人工智能问题分解为多个小问题,并让各自相对独立的多个处理单元并发地同时解决这些小问题,从而有效提高运算速度和效率。-并行计算技术可以有效减少人工智能任务执行时间,提高任务处理效率,使人工智能系统能够及时处理海量数据和执行复杂任务,从而实现更好的性能和更强的人工智能能力。-并行计算技术可以提高人工智能系统的可扩展性,使人工智能系统能够随着任务规模的增加而不断地扩展,从而满足不断增长的计算需求,并支持更大型、更复杂的人工智能应用的开发和运行。2.并行计算技术的应用领域:-图像和视频处理:并行计算技术可以加速图像和视频的处理和分析,支持图像和视频的快速识别、分类、编辑和增强等任务的执行,从而提升人工智能系统的图像和视频处理能力。-自然语言处理:并行计算技术可以支持自然语言处理任务的快速执行,包括文本摘要、文本分类、机器翻译、语音识别和情感分析等任务,从而提升人工智能系统的自然语言处理能力。-数据挖掘和分析:并行计算技术可以支持大规模数据的挖掘和分析,包括数据清理、数据转换、特征提取和数据建模等任务的执行,从而提升人工智能系统的挖掘和分析能力。-机器学习和深度学习:并行计算技术可以支持机器学习和深度学习模型的快速训练和预测,包括模型参数优化、特征工程和超参数调整等任务的执行,从而提升人工智能系统的学习和预测能力。

并行计算技术在人工智能中的应用并行计算在人工智能中的挑战,1.算法设计和优化:并行计算技术在人工智能中的应用需要设计和优化并行算法,以充分利用并行计算资源提高计算效率,同时也要考虑算法的可伸缩性和容错性,以满足实际应用需求。2.并行编程和开发:并行计算技术在人工智能中的应用需要进行并行编程和开发,包括并行数据结构、并行算法和并行通信机制的设计和实现,这需要开发人员具备一定的并行编程知识和技能。3.硬件和系统支持:并行计算技术在人工智能中的应用需要硬件和系统支持,包括并行处理器的选择、并行计算环境的构建和并行计算资源的管理,以确保并行计算任务能够高效地执行。4.能耗和散热:并行计算技术在人工智能中的应用需要考虑能耗和散热问题,因为并行计算任务通常需要大量的计算资源,因此需要优化算法和并行编程策略以减少能耗和散热,并采用适当的散热措施以确保系统稳定运行。

并行计算技术在机器学习中的应用并行计算在人工智能与机器学习中的应用

并行计算技术在机器学习中的应用分布式机器学习1.通过将机器学习任务分配给多个计算节点,分布式机器学习可以有效提高训练和预测速度,尤其适用于处理大规模数据集。2.分布式机器学习框架,如ApacheSparkMLlib、TensorFlowDistributed和PyTorchDistributed,提供了丰富的API和

文档评论(0)

科技之佳文库 + 关注
官方认证
内容提供者

科技赋能未来,创新改变生活!

版权声明书
用户编号:8131073104000017
认证主体重庆有云时代科技有限公司
IP属地上海
统一社会信用代码/组织机构代码
9150010832176858X3

1亿VIP精品文档

相关文档